Alfred Buntru

Alfred Buntru , (born January 15, 1887 in Schlageten / Baden (today part of the city of St. Blasien ), † January 23, 1974 in Aachen ) was a Sudeten German university professor. He was professor for hydraulic engineering and deputy lecturer leader .

Live and act

Buntru began studying engineering at the Technical University of Karlsruhe in 1905 and was active in the Karlsruhe fraternity of Tulla from 1905 . After graduating in 1910, Buntru was then responsible for the expansion of the Kaiser Wilhelm Canal (today's Kiel Canal), a new Baltic Sea lock and the construction of the pier for the Navy in Kiel . Finally, in 1914, he was initially taken on as a government builder in Karlsruhe, before taking part as a volunteer in World War I , most recently with the rank of first lieutenant . In 1919 he received his doctorate. Ing and in 1922 the habilitation took place in Karlsruhe.

After a year as a professor at the Tung Chi University in Shanghai , Buntru was professor at the German Technical University in Prague from 1928 to 1936 . In 1935/36 he was rector of the TH Prague. In 1936 he was appointed full professor for hydraulic engineering at the Technical University of Aachen. He joined the NSDAP in 1937 (membership number 3,979,305) and a year later the SS (membership number 313,909). At that time he carried out spy services for the SD . From 1936 to 1939 Buntru was rector of the TH Aachen . From 1939 to 1945 Buntru was again professor at the DTH Prague, where he was rector again between 1940 and 1945. In 1942/43 he was also appointed acting rector of the Tetschen-Liebwerd Agricultural University and the German Charles University in Prague . Buntru was also head of the Reinhard Heydrich Foundation . In 1943 he was appointed Gaudozentenführer Sudetenland and in 1944 Deputy Reichsdozentenführer. At that time, as SS-Oberführer he was confidante of the Sudeten German politician and SS-Obergruppenführer Konrad Henlein .

After the end of the Second World War and with the help of letters of discharge for his personal denazification procedure , issued by the post-war rector Paul Röntgen and others, he was again given a teaching position in Aachen in 1949 for hydrology , industrial hydraulic engineering and hydraulics , which he held until his retirement in 1962 exercised. On December 3, 1958, Alfred Buntru was made an honorary senator of RWTH Aachen University " in recognition of his great services to the Rheinisch Westfälische Technische Hochschule Aachen and his high level of commitment ". Since his return to Aachen, Buntru has been active in the Sudeten German Landsmannschaft .

As part of its processing of the activities of its university members during the Third Reich, the Historical Institute of RWTH Aachen University deals intensively with the work of Alfred Buntru with several literary writings.
